Scrub Honeyeater Meliphaga albonotata
Described by: Salvadori (1876)
Alternate common name(s): Scrub White-eared Honeyeater, Diamond Honeyeater, White-eyed Honeyeater, Southern Honeyeater, White-marked Meliphaga, White-marked Honeyeater, White-marked Scrub Honeyeater
Old scientific name(s): Meliphaga auga
